Superbirds had three engine options: the 426 Hemi V8 engine producing 425bhp (431PS; 317kW) at 5000 rpm and 490lbft (664Nm) at 4000 rpm of torque, the 440 Super Commando Six Barrel with 3X2-barrel carburetors producing 390hp (290kW) and the 375hp (280kW) 440 Super Commando with a single 4-barrel carburetor. [3], The car's primary rivals were the Ford Torino Talladega and Mercury Cyclone, a direct response to the Mopar aero car. The Plymouth Superbird is a highly modified, short-lived version of the Plymouth Road Runner with applied graphic images as well as a distinctive horn sound both referencing the popular Looney Tunes cartoon character the Road Runner.
